As the 18th December draws near....

MELBOURNE, HONG KONG: 4th December 2009 --  The 5th December will be a timely reminder - the celebration of Blessed Philip Rinaldi, of the major and long-awaited event for this year in terms of the Salesian 150th celebration: 18th December and the renewal of profession on the part of all Salesians.
    You will be happy to know that gleanings 2 and gleanings 3 are now available, along with 'gleanings 1' which has been in place for several weeks.  No 2 is blue and No. 3 is green, unless you are colour blind (in which case just go by order!!). These 'gleanings',  'Twitter-like' reflections on the Constitutions, come at a timely moment and have already spread far and wide; they can be found on websites now in various continents.  Once again, if you actually want a zipped version of the 3 'gleanings' to include in a web site, just ask and you will have it by return mail.  Some readers have already worked out how to get hold of the script and its contents by other simple, technical means. Good for them!
    Meanwhile, Salesians in HK and Macau, if one is to believe Fides who have renamed the Rector Major as 'Inspector General', have been celebrating the 150th in a big way. One could be forgiven, from the article concerned, in thinking that we have had an enormous vocation surge in that part of the world, but that can be taken as a good omen!  If you wish to read the more subdued and ultimately more correct version written by our own people from Hong Kong, and published by us on 19th November, just go here.
